Subject: RE: BS: Is someone on my computer???? Skarpi... From: Rapparee Date: 06 Feb 04 - 04:13 PM Skarpi, just be sure to keep your anti-virus software up to date. It will protect your computer from viruses and worms and such things. You might want to scan the whole computer every week or two. That way the bad guys will be stopped. If you don't know the person email comes from, don't open any attachments. Of course, you can still get a virus from someone you do know. That's why you have to keep the antivirus up to date. Unless the antivirus scan of your computer showed a problem I'd just ignore this message. |
